Kabūdarāhang weather in June

In June, Kabūdarāhang sees average daytime highs of 32°C and overnight lows near 15°C, with 3 mm of rain across 1 wet days and about 14.3 hours of daylight. It is the 3rd-warmest and 9th-wettest month of the year here.

Highs climb over the month, from about 30°C in the first days to 34°C by the end.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 84% of the time in June, and the air most often feels dry.

Daylight stretches from about 14 h 12 min at the start of June to 14 h 24 min by month's end. Set against the rest of the year, June is Kabūdarāhang's 4th-clearest and 3rd-windiest month. For the whole year in context, see Kabūdarāhang's year-round climate.

Temperature in June

Average highAverage lowShaded bands: 10–90% of days

Highs climb over the month, from about 30°C in the first days to 34°C by the end.

A typical June day in Kabūdarāhang reaches about 32°C in the afternoon and slips back to 15°C overnight — a 17°C spread between the day's warmth and the night's chill. On most days the high lands between 28°C and 35°C. Set against its neighbours, June runs about 7°C warmer than May and about 3°C cooler than July.

Location & terrain

Where is Kabūdarāhang?

Kabūdarāhang sits at 35.2°N, 48.7°E, 1,670 m above sea level, in Iran. The nearest listed city is Bahār, 42 km away.

MalāyerQīdarKangāvar

Topography around Kabūdarāhang

How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 3, 16 and 80 km of Kabūdarāhang.

Within 3 km, the terrain around Kabūdarāhang has only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 20 m around an average of 1,673 m above sea level; within 16 km, signific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 553 m; within 80 km, very signific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 2,036 m.

The land around Kabūdarāhang is covered by cropland (66%) and artificial surfaces (21%) within 3 km, cropland (84%) within 16 km, and cropland (61%) and grassland (27%) within 80 km.
